In Memoriam- Chris “Buzz” Deardorff

The Phish community has lost a Phan. Chris Deardorff, better known as Buzz recently passed away, leaving behind a wife and daughter. He’s best known as the guitarist of Quagmire Swim Team, and most recently Pine Mountain Band. He was an amazing person, with one of the most positive attitudes I’ve ever seen. It was always a pleasure to see him perform, and an honor to eventually become a close friend. He is one of the best guitarists I’ve ever heard, and I used to regularly make the 6 hour drive from college to see them play in my hometown.
I got to know Buzz throughout the year, mainly through my friend Jeff Whetstone, who would get together with him and play often, eventually forming Pine Mountain Band. Our mutual love of Phish brought us even closer. It was exciting to hear his stories of going on tour, and the ridiculous situations he got himself in. We went to several Phish shows together, and seeing his excitement and joy made the shows so much better. My wife and I were lucky enough to be with him at his last show, 8/16/15 MPP, which was his 132nd show. It was a large group of us, and it seemed like we gravitated towards him. All these people getting together because of him. It’s fitting that he’s in the center of this picture:

Buzz will be dearly missed by his friends and fans alike. We are saddened, but can’t help but smile thinking about the great times we had together, as a friend, with his family, or in the audience.

Phish Magnaball 8/21-8/23/15

Friday, 08/21/2015
Watkins Glen International, Watkins Glen, NY
Set 1: Simple > The Dogs > The Man Who Stepped Into Yesterday > Avenu Malkenu> The Man Who Stepped Into Yesterday > Free, The Wedge, Mock Song, Roggae >Rift, Bathtub Gin
Set 2: Chalk Dust Torture[1] > Ghost -> Rock and Roll > Harry Hood -> Waste > No Men In No Man’s Land -> Slave to the Traffic Light
Encore: Farmhouse, First Tube
[1] Unfinished.
Teases:
· What’s the Use? tease in Chalk Dust Torture
· Cars Trucks Buses tease in Harry Hood
· Magilla tease in Simple
Notes: This show was webcast via LivePhish and was the first show of the Magnaball festival. Page teased Magilla in Simple. TMWSIY and Avenu Malkenu were played for the first time since July 4, 2012 (124 shows). After Free, Trey asked the crowd to sing Happy Birthday to his daughter, Eliza, who briefly joined him onstage. Mock Song was played for the first time since July 12, 2003 (320 shows), and featured a lyric change to “Clifford, Super, Magnaball.” CDT contained a What’s the Use? tease and was unfinished. Hood contained a CTB tease from Mike.

Saturday, 08/22/2015
Watkins Glen International, Watkins Glen, NY
Set 1: Divided Sky, The Moma Dance > Mound, Army of One, Scabbard > Sample in a Jar, Tube, Halfway to the Moon, Camel Walk, How Many People Are You?, When the Circus Comes, Undermind > Run Like an Antelope
Set 2: Wolfman’s Brother, Halley’s Comet > 46 Days -> Backwards Down the Number Line > Tweezer > Prince Caspian[1]
Set 3: Meatstick > Blaze On -> Possum > Cities > Light > 555, Wading in the Velvet Sea > Walls of the Cave
Encore: Boogie On Reggae Woman > Tweezer Reprise
Set 4: Drive-In Jam
[1] Unfinished.
Teases:
· Tweezer tease in Prince Caspian
· Mind Left Body Jam tease in Cities
Notes: This show was webcast via LivePhish and was the second show of the Magnaball festival. Caspian included a Tweezer tease and was unfinished. Cities contained a Mind Left Body Jam tease. The Fourth Set Drive-In Jam started with the band playing behind the “Drive In Movie” screen that had been created for the festival. Slowly, their silhouettes became visible and the ambient jam veered towards a full on band jam while the screen simultaneously showed fractal like images of close-ups of the band. Eventually, the band was visible.

Sunday, 08/23/2015
Watkins Glen International, Watkins Glen, NY
Set 1: Punch You In the Eye > Buffalo Bill, A Song I Heard the Ocean Sing > Limb By Limb, Waiting All Night > Theme From the Bottom > Maze, The Line, Stash, Reba, I Didn’t Know[1], Character Zero
Set 2: Martian Monster > Down with Disease[2] -> Scents and Subtle Sounds ->What’s the Use? > Dirt > Mike’s Song > Fuego > Twist -> Weekapaug Groove[2] ->Martian Monster
Encore: You Enjoy Myself
[1] Trey thanked the crew, production staff and local officials.
[2] Unfinished.
Teases:
· The Tears of a Clown tease
· Immigrant Song and Mainstreet quotes in Weekapaug Groove
· Immigrant Song tease & quote in Twist
· Brick House, The Very Long Fuse, and Sanity teases in You Enjoy Myself
Notes: This show was webcast via LivePhish and was the third show of the Magnaball festival. Mike teased The Tears of a Clown before Punch You In the Eye. Buffalo Bill was played for the first time since June 22, 2012 (134 shows). Trey thanked the fans, crew, production staff and local officials during I Didn’t Know while Fishman “sucked love” on his vacuum. Down with Disease was unfinished. Immigrant Song was teased in both Twist and Weekapaug Groove. Mainstreet was teased in Weekapaug Groove, which was unfinished. YEM contained a Brick House tease from Mike, Sanity quotes in the vocal jam, and culminated with a quote from The Very Long Fuse and a fireworks display.
